toke.c: Report the proper type for assign ops
For combined assignment operators like *= and +=, the lexer passes an
ASSIGNOP token to the parser, but the -DT output said MULOP or ADDOP;
i.e., it was reporting the type *before* the check for a following
‘=’, instead of after it.
